Honda ‘give back' with Red Bull engine request

Honda felt obliged to accept Red Bull's request for the 2022 engine due to their 'huge appreciation' towards Helmut Marko and Franz Tost. The Japanese manufacturer will leave Formula 1 at the end of 2021, which led to the formation of Red Bull Powertrains to take over engine development for the Red Bull and AlphaTauri teams. But for 2022, the engines will still come from Honda's Sakura base at the request of Red Bull in what will be a transitional year. And when the request came, Honda's F1 managing director Masashi Yamamoto told BBC Sport the manufacturer felt 'huge admiration' for Red Bull's driver programme chief Marko and AlphaTauri boss Tost, and so the desire to give back.
